Kay Barnes Named Equity Manager For Everett, Washington

July 13, 2020

Everett Government

Word in from Mayor Cassie Franklin that she has selected Kay Barnes as Equity Manager for the City of Everett, Washington.

Kay Barnes, photo courtesy City of Everett.

I’m very pleased to announce Kay Barnes has accepted a position as the City’s new equity manager. Kay has been employed with the City since 2006 as part of our human resources team. She has worked as part of our interdepartmental team on community engagement and inclusion and I know she will be a great champion and leader of this work for us.

In her new role, Kay’s focus will be on developing, promoting and maintaining an internal culture of equity. She will work to ensure our staff reflect the diversity of our city, that the City is a safe place to work for our diverse staff, and that the City is well-connected to our Black, Indigenous and people of color communities. We look forward to sharing more about this work in coming months.

Please join me in welcoming Kay as our new equity manager. We look forward to working together with our community to ensure Everett is a safe place for all to live and work.
